Programming Practices (CS-406) [Python]
rgpv bhopal, diploma, rgpv syllabus, rgpv time table, how to get transcript from rgpv, rgpvonline,rgpv question paper, rgpv online question paper, rgpv admit card, rgpv papers, rgpv scheme
B.Tech RGPV notes AICTE flexible curricula Bachelor of technology
Syllabus
UNIT 1:
Introduction: Basic syntax, Literal Constants, Numbers, Variable and Basic data types,
String, Escape Sequences, Operators and Expressions, Evaluation Order, Indentation, Input
Output, Functions, Comments.
UNIT 2:
Data Structure: List, Tuples, Dictionary and Sets.
UNIT 3:
Control Flow: Conditional Statements - If, If-else, Nested If-else. Iterative Statement -
For, While, Nested Loops. Control statements - Break, Continue, Pass.
UNIT 4:
Object oriented programming: Class and Object, Attributes, Methods, Scopes and
Namespaces, Inheritance, Overloading, Overriding, Data hiding.
UNIT 5:
Exception: Exception Handling, Except clause, Try finally clause, User Defined
Exceptions.
UNIT 6:
Exception: Exception Handling, Except clause, Try finally clause, User Defined
Exceptions.
UNIT 7:
Exception: Exception Handling, Except clause, Try finally clause, User Defined
Exceptions.
NOTES
- Unit 1
- Unit 2
- Unit 3
- Unit 4
- Unit 5
Books Recommended
Timothy A. Budd: Exploring python, McGraw-Hill Education.
R.Nageshwar Rao ,”Python Programming” ,Wiley India
Think Python: Allen B. Downey, O'Reilly Media, Inc
You May Also Like
- BT-401 - Mathematics- III
- CS-402 - Analysis Design of Algorithm
- CS-403 - Software Engineering
- CS-404 - Computer Org. & Architecture
- CS-405 - Operating Systems
- CS-406 - Programming Practices
- CS-406 - Programming Practices
- CS-406 - Programming Practices
- BT-407 - 90 hrs Internship based on using various software’s –Internship -II
- BT-408 - Cyber Security